              ESP-201 has a connector for external antenna. It is possible to use the longer antenna included in the package, or use a pigtail to connect any external antenna.
              https://www.aliexpress.com/item/ESP8266-Serial-Port-WIFI-Wireless-Transceiver-Send-Receive-Module-IO-Lead-Out-ESP-201/32386697778.html
              Note that ESP-201 is not as user-friendly as the nodemcu and wemos. You will need a ftdi adapter and some external connections to program it.
